Tender description

The University Hospitals Birmingham NHSFT (the "Authority") is seeking a Provider with the appropriate product range, experience and competitive pricing to supply it with Gas Therapy Equipment and associated accessories services as follows: Supply of Associated Accessories; Supply of Spare Parts & Accessories (for in-house maintenance); <br/>Initial and on-going clinical and technical training; Fully comprehensive warranty cover for contract term (including extensions) Lot 1: • Supply of Gas Therapy Equipment<br/>• Supply of Associated Accessories <br/>• Supply of Spare Parts & Accessories (for in-house maintenance)<br/>• Initial and on-going clinical and technical training<br/>• Fully comprehensive warranty cover for contract term (including extensions).<br/><br/>To cover the rolling replacement of existing devices and additional requirements due to expansion within the Trust. <br/><br/>Training must be competency based and independently assessed, and where possible RCN accredited (Examples of documentation/evidence to be provided)<br/><br/>All training records must be provided to the Trust Medical Devices Training Lead.<br/><br/>Training content tailored to the needs of the audience and in variety of settings shall be required during the course of this contract. This will include but is not restricted to seminars, demonstrations, clinical based sessions both during and outside normal working hours e.g. to cover night staff.<br/><br/>The provider must provide details of all their trainers who will be involved with the contract including their training qualifications and training experience. Should any changes occur to trainers during the contract these details must be provided to the Trust in a timely manner.<br/><br/>Users manuals/guides and other training aids must be provided. These should be available via a variety of mediums hard back, CD Rom, Trust Intranet.<br/><br/>Training for new starters and refresher training must be provided as part of the Trust’s programme of training courses.<br/><br/>In addition, there may be a requirement for the provider to attend, support and/or lead ad-hoc weekly training over and above the scheduled training (above in 6.1) ranging from 30 minutes to 2 hours. <br/><br/>Training/learning information must be regularly reviewed no less than annually and updates provided in an agreed format to the Trust.<br/><br/>Any consumables required for training purposes must be provided free of charge for the length of the contract.<br/><br/>All training costs must be shown separately in the offer/pricing schedule.<br/><br/>All necessary test equipment must be provided free of charge as part of this contract. <br/><br/>These devices are maintained by the Medical Engineering team and this will continue following the award of the new contract.<br/><br/>All service costs must be stated separately within the offer/pricing schedule provided.<br/><br/>The provider should provide free of charge second line accredited technical/configuration training places for a minimum of 10 staff.<br/><br/>On-site technical training is preferable, however should off site training be required, any associated accommodation costs must be borne by the provider as part of their bid.<br/><br/>Spare parts must be delivered as minimum within 48 hours.<br/><br/>Full details of spare parts must be provided by the successful provider.<br/> <br/>Providers must provide details of support including telephone support hours, engineers call out hours and response times, stores opening hours during which time replacement parts can be ordered, located and dispatched.
